I always incubate my double yolkers (I keep quail not chickens), and only one hatched and it was recent. I got one chick and one gross blob of red goo. I didn’t see it hatch, I had put it in with a couple special marked eggs all separated from the normies by having a strawberry carton upside down over them, and I woke up on hatch day and had 3 chicks and a blob of goo, with 3 empty shells, no idea who was who, but clearly only one came out of the double. They had both been wiggling at day 9, at lockdown it was just a dark egg with some visible veins and maybe movement visible in the air cell. I couldn’t differentiate two any more like I could at the earlier candling. It looked like the chicks had been pecking the goo, and they all had it on them 🤢. It definitely wasn’t yolk sac, it was far more solid. The 3 chicks who could have been the twin all grew normally and had no issues, and I think I was super lucky that one twin made it.

:sick Yes, that's a very lucky baby! Normally when the twin quits early the other chick doesn't make it because of bacteria. That was a little miracle quail!
